1. Understanding How HTML5 Games Work On PC
HTML5 has transformed web browsers from just portals for surfing into fully-fledged entertainment engines. With powerful support for JavaScript, WebGL rendering capabilities, and robust APIs, browsers like Chrome and Edge today run full-scale 3D HTML5 games smoothly without requiring installations or add-ons such as Adobe Flash which was deprecated long ago. Let's take a quick peek at the core mechanics:- Cross-platform compatibility: Whether it's an i5 running Windows 10 or budget-friendly AMD setups – they all work flawlessly due to browser-based nature of HTML5 games.
- Faster Load times: Brought about by lightweight assets combined with asynchronous resource streaming (unlike installing large game packs before launching).
- No updates necessary. Developers auto-deploy new levels and bug patches on server-end ensuring gamers play what's fresh & tested – always.
